ok place every now and then
by hardboiled
Compared to some of the other Children's Museums we have been to like Seattle and San Jose, Portland's seems lacking in the amount of interactive and learning fun. We used to have a membership but after a year's worth of playing at the Children's museum, my son actually got bored of it.
We go every now and then, but the exhibits are often disappointing and I feel like they have so much space and don't use it very well. The new theater shows do not hold the attention span of my now 5 year old and the shadow/tree walkway seems like filler for what could be so much more interesting. The train table area is always a disaster when kids won't share and the building area doesn't seem to quite work all that well. The market is really fun but overall, there are a lot of useless exhibits. That being said, my son does enjoy going there now that we only go every 6 months or so and we had a very good birthday party there as well. As family friendly as Portland is, I think they should up the quality of the museum and put more into it.
- Pros: Colorful and attractive for kids, lots of space and the market area is a lot of fun
- Cons: Exhibits can be weak
The museum's location next to the Oregon Zoo means tons of space for interactivity and fun for little ones.
by Contributor
In Short
Kids can do miniature construction at the Building Bridgetown exhibit, feed and clothe baby dolls or do other medicine-related activites at Kids Care, splash around in Water Works and create colorful works of art with clay, paint and various crafting materials. For an afternoon of fun, it's well-worth the admission price.
